Hong Kong, Shanghai: Shares drop as Fed rally vanishes
Published Mon, Sep 26, 2016 · 08:51 AM
[HONG KONG] Hong Kong shares dropped Monday in line with other Asian markets as last week's Fed-sparked rally dissipated.
The Hang Seng Index shed 1.56 per cent, or 368.56 points, to close at 23,317.92.
The benchmark Shanghai Composite Index lost 1.76 per cent, or 53.47 points, to 2,980.43.
The Shenzhen Composite Index, which tracks stocks on China's second exchange, slid 2.07 per cent, or 41.52 points, to 1,966.60.
